Output 73dcd8930dbdb3456b9bb5d7bfdf44cad3883d695f1cf5894de753b1386929ab:7

value
148136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8198c8f13453eac8f5f4cb747f250a857baba00e OP_EQUAL
address
3DWG7yPGanVM2gSjk49rcF2SgufcpCVNSd
transaction
73dcd8930dbdb3456b9bb5d7bfdf44cad3883d695f1cf5894de753b1386929ab
confirmations
441980
spent
true